I'm currently working on my BS in Biomedical Electronics through Thomas Edison State University (TESU), and I'm running into a bit of a challenge with some of the required courses.
TESU's program is "transfer-oriented," meaning they don't actually offer the core Biomedical Electronics courses themselves. We're expected to find these courses at other colleges or universities and then transfer them in for approval.
Specifically, I need to find four (4) Biomedical Electronics Electives. These are specialized courses, and I'm finding it tough to pinpoint where I can take them online or via distance learning that would then transfer back to TESU.
Has anyone here completed a similar program or found good sources for these types of specialized Biomedical Electronics courses? Any recommendations for specific institutions, online course providers, or even course titles that might fit the bill would be incredibly helpful!
